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/297.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 从字体实例获取FontFamily_C#_Fonts_Font Family - Fatal编程技术网

C# 从字体实例获取FontFamily

C# 从字体实例获取FontFamily,c#,fonts,font-family,C#,Fonts,Font Family,如标题中所述,我有一个字体实例,我将使用FontFamily来构建该字体实例 我需要那个特定的家庭距离(或是同等距离的距离) 编辑: 正如所问,我使用Winform(在windows mobile上,所以我使用NetCF 3.5)您可以使用它来获取字体的FontFamily: FontFamily ff = oldFont.FontFamily; 更新-在.NET CF中,所有类都进行了优化,以最小化资源使用。因此,FontFamily属性在Font类中不存在。WPF(System.Windo

如标题中所述,我有一个字体实例,我将使用FontFamily来构建该字体实例

我需要那个特定的家庭距离(或是同等距离的距离)

编辑:
正如所问,我使用Winform(在windows mobile上,所以我使用NetCF 3.5)

您可以使用它来获取
字体的
FontFamily

FontFamily ff = oldFont.FontFamily;

更新-在.NET CF中,所有类都进行了优化,以最小化资源使用。因此,FontFamily属性在
Font
类中不存在。

WPF(
System.Windows.Media.Font
)或WinForms(
System.Drawing.Font
)?@FarhanAnam我在NetCF 3.5上使用winform如何获取字体实例?我在生成控件时调用getter。调用此.Font获取用户设置的字体(选择FontFamily),但我没有FontFamily方法覆盖字体实例。您可以将
this.Font
分配给
var
并告诉我其类型吗?我在NetCF(我的visual studio屏幕截图)中没有这样的方法。你能把
this.Font
分配给
var
并告诉我它的类型吗?然后我就知道该用什么了。好吧,正如你建议的,我用StringMetric而不是FontFamily来获得EmSize。